5(1)The Commission must appoint a chief executive, who is to be an employee of the Commission.E+W

(2)The Commission may appoint such other employees as it considers appropriate.

(3)Employees of the Commission are to be appointed on such terms and conditions as the Commission may determine.

(4)Without prejudice to its other powers, the Commission may pay, or make provision for the payment of—

(a)pensions, allowances and gratuities, or

(b)compensation for loss of employment or reduction of remuneration,

to or in respect of its employees.

[F1(5)Before making a determination as to remuneration, pensions, allowances or gratuities for the purposes of sub-paragraph (3) or (4), the Commission must obtain the approval of the Secretary of State to its policy on that matter.]
